I bought a couple of trailer LED lights last week. Very robust and waterproof.
Only $69 each (combination brake/night/indictor)
Got them at an auto electrical place in Brisbane.
This is as cheap as I could find which were fully sealed.
ADR approved.
If you get lights like this I suggest you either put them where they wont get clobbered or protect them with strong surrounds.

ditch wrote:just a bit sceptical about no reverse light, cos i would have NO idea how to wire up a work light for reverse
I got a hella working light for reverse...
http://db.hella.com.au/cgi-bin/catalogu ... maint=2105
Just a matter of hooking it up to the old reverse wires, works well.
